Bonus rounds

Bonus rounds are mini-games played in slot machines that are both exciting and thrilling and give players the chance of winning extra prizes outside the main game. They can take many different types, ranging from simple click-and-click games to more interactive ones with many stages and increased payouts. These features can increase your winning potential and add a new dimension to the games.

To activate a bonus round in a slot game you must get a specific symbol combination on the reels. Depending on the game, this may include a scatter symbol, three or more wild symbols, or a collection meters. The number of symbols required to trigger a bonus round will differ from one game to another, but you can find out the pay table.

Certain slots also come with bonuses that allows you to buy and activate any bonus rounds within the game. This feature can boost the odds of winning and is especially useful if you are playing at high stakes. But, you must be aware that the cost of buying a bonus game will be based on the original stake.

Bonus rounds are a popular feature among slot players because they provide a new level of excitement and the chance to win big payouts. Reels

In the earliest mechanical slot machines the reels were made of paper strips and later, plastic, with various symbols. The reels were laid out in a pattern which determined the payouts and odds for a specific spin. Modern slot machines use the random number generator (RNG) to replace this mechanism, but the concept remains the same. The RNG generates thousands of three-number combinations each second, and determines the order in which symbols appear on paylines when the reels stop.

Slot games come with reels of all shapes and sizes. From the basic 3x1 slot to the enthralling 5x3 video slot, there are a myriad of possibilities. It is ultimately the player's preference as to which one they prefer to play with. However, it is important to know how reel arrays operate to help you make the best choice for your gaming needs.

The paytable of slot machines will display all the symbols available, their payouts and any additional features, such as wilds or scatters. The Paytable will also give details about the number of paylines. This will allow players to determine the maximum payout and the RTP and the level of volatility of the game.

Paylines

In slot games, the number of paylines determines the amount of ways a player can win on a single turn. The more identical symbols on the payline, the greater the chance of winning. Most slots only pay out if there three or more matching icons on a payline. However you can still be a winner if you have two or four matching symbols.

The shape and direction of a payline can vary. Some run horizontally, vertically or diagonally, while others are simple straight lines. Whatever the form, all paylines must be able to cover a single reel and have at least three symbols to be able to pay out.

Players can often see the number of paylines that are active in a slot game by studying the pay table. This will also show the multiplier value of the paylines, which are determined by how many symbols are on a particular payline. They can vary from three to 600x your total stake. The pay table will tell you if there are any symbols that are unique to the game that pay more than the typical fruit or playing cards.
